Patents by Inventor Don Adams

Don Adams has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11549832
    Abstract: Devices, systems, and methods for explosion resistance include an analysis compartment isolated from a control compartment. A feed-through extends between the analysis compartment and the control compartment for extension of cabling therethrough, the feed-through hermetically sealed to block against flow of fluids between the analysis and control compartments.
    Type: Grant
    Filed: June 11, 2021
    Date of Patent: January 10, 2023
    Assignee: ABB Schweiz AG
    Inventors: Michael J. May, Don Adams, Brian C. Smith, Tony E. Moore, Brian J. Robertson
  • Publication number: 20220397434
    Abstract: Devices, systems, and methods for explosion resistance include an analysis compartment isolated from a control compartment. A feed-through extends between the analysis compartment and the control compartment for extension of cabling therethrough, the feed-through hermetically sealed to block against flow of fluids between the analysis and control compartments.
    Type: Application
    Filed: June 11, 2021
    Publication date: December 15, 2022
    Inventors: Michael J. MAY, Don ADAMS, Brian C. SMITH, Tony E. MOORE, Brian J. ROBERTSON
  • Publication number: 20220397433
    Abstract: Devices, systems, and methods for explosion resistance include an explosion-resistant enclosure and a lid assembly. The lid assembly includes a lid for enclosing an opening of the explosion-resistant enclosure, and a graphical display assembly for presenting visual information regarding the analysis equipment.
    Type: Application
    Filed: June 11, 2021
    Publication date: December 15, 2022
    Inventors: Michael J. MAY, Don ADAMS, Brian C. SMITH, Tony E. MOORE, Brian J. ROBERTSON
  • Patent number: 9505202
    Abstract: A fabric tube with two passages comprises a fabric tube sheet. A first fabric weld strip with right and left flanges extending laterally from a bottom edge of a weld fin is welded to a first surface extending the length of the fabric tube sheet at a distance D1 from the first edge thereof A second fabric weld strip is welded to an opposite second surface and extends the length of the fabric tube sheet between the first fabric weld strip and the second edge of the fabric tube sheet at a distance D2 from the second edge of the fabric tube sheet. The first edge of the fabric tube sheet is welded to the weld fin of the second fabric weld strip and the second edge of the fabric tube sheet is welded to the weld fin of the first fabric weld strip to form two passages.
    Type: Grant
    Filed: February 5, 2015
    Date of Patent: November 29, 2016
    Assignee: ABC Canada Technology Group LTD.
    Inventors: Don Adams, James Yausie, Bobby Hack, Paul Yausie
  • Publication number: 20150151529
    Abstract: A fabric tube with two passages comprises a fabric tube sheet. A first fabric weld strip with right and left flanges extending laterally from a bottom edge of a weld fin is welded to a first surface extending the length of the fabric tube sheet at a distance D1 from the first edge thereof A second fabric weld strip is welded to an opposite second surface and extends the length of the fabric tube sheet between the first fabric weld strip and the second edge of the fabric tube sheet at a distance D2 from the second edge of the fabric tube sheet. The first edge of the fabric tube sheet is welded to the weld fin of the second fabric weld strip and the second edge of the fabric tube sheet is welded to the weld fin of the first fabric weld strip to form two passages.
    Type: Application
    Filed: February 5, 2015
    Publication date: June 4, 2015
    Inventors: Don Adams, James Yausie, Bobby Hack, Paul Yausie
  • Patent number: 8985158
    Abstract: A fabric tube with two passages comprises a fabric tube sheet. A first fabric weld strip with right and left flanges extending laterally from a bottom edge of a weld fin is welded to a first surface extending the length of the fabric tube sheet at a distance D1 from the first edge thereof. A second fabric weld strip is welded to an opposite second surface and extends the length of the fabric tube sheet between the first fabric weld strip and the second edge of the fabric tube sheet at a distance D2 from the second edge of the fabric tube sheet. The first edge of the fabric tube sheet is welded to the weld fin of the second fabric weld strip and the second edge of the fabric tube sheet is welded to the weld fin of the first fabric weld strip to form two passages.
    Type: Grant
    Filed: April 5, 2012
    Date of Patent: March 24, 2015
    Assignee: ABC Canada Technology Group Ltd.
    Inventors: Don Adams, James Yausie, Bob Hack, Paul Yausie
  • Patent number: 8825594
    Abstract: Example systems and methods are directed at maintaining and retrieving presence metadata. One example method includes receiving a request from a first client to edit a document file, and sending short-term check out metadata to the first client to begin an editing session. The method also includes writing the transition ID to a transition table stored in a cache, wherein the presence of another transition ID in the cache indicates that a document has switched from a single-client mode to a multi-client mode. An example system includes a processing unit operative to receive a document, the document including short-term check out metadata indicating an editing session has begun, ping a cache to determine if another transition ID is stored in the cache, and send a transition ID to a transition table stored in a cache to switch from a single-client mode to a multi-client mode.
    Type: Grant
    Filed: May 8, 2008
    Date of Patent: September 2, 2014
    Assignee: Microsoft Corporation
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Publication number: 20130233434
    Abstract: A fabric tube with two passages comprises a fabric tube sheet. A first fabric weld strip with right and left flanges extending laterally from a bottom edge of a weld fin is welded to a first surface extending the length of the fabric tube sheet at a distance D1 from the first edge thereof. A second fabric weld strip is welded to an opposite second surface and extends the length of the fabric tube sheet between the first fabric weld strip and the second edge of the fabric tube sheet at a distance D2 from the second edge of the fabric tube sheet. The first edge of the fabric tube sheet is welded to the weld fin of the second fabric weld strip and the second edge of the fabric tube sheet is welded to the weld fin of the first fabric weld strip to form two passages.
    Type: Application
    Filed: April 5, 2012
    Publication date: September 12, 2013
    Inventors: Don Adams, James Yausie, Bob Hack, Paul Yausie
  • Patent number: 8429753
    Abstract: Examples are related to systems and methods for controlling access to document files on a document server. One example system includes document files stored on a document server, at least one of the document files referencing a file lock, and a document access processing module. The example document access processing module includes a file sharing processing module that determines a coauthoring status of a software application of a client computer requesting access to the document file, and a file lock processing module that stores one or more file locks and that controls the setting and resetting of file locks. The example document access processing module uses the coauthoring status of the software application and the file lock status of a document file to determine whether a software application is permitted to have write access to the document file.
    Type: Grant
    Filed: May 8, 2008
    Date of Patent: April 23, 2013
    Assignee: Microsoft Corporation
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Publication number: 20130039776
    Abstract: A hand paddle having a handle (hand grip) attached to the hand paddle blade allows the user to grip the hand paddle intuitively and ergonomically for use in whitewater with kayaks or boats. The paddle blade has a contoured hand well, which allows the handle to be positioned closer to the hand paddle blade substantially reducing the rotating force (torque) to the user's hands. The handle configuration allows user to quickly release the paddle in order to use hands in case of an emergency. The hand paddle further comprises a hand strap to prevent the paddle from rotating/pivoting in the user's hands. The hand paddle further comprises a lanyard, designed to break away under the weight of the user, securing the hand paddle to the user's wrist or forearm.
    Type: Application
    Filed: August 12, 2011
    Publication date: February 14, 2013
    Inventor: Don Adams
  • Publication number: 20120254315
    Abstract: Example systems and methods are directed at maintaining and retrieving presence metadata. One example method includes receiving a request from a first client to edit a document file, and sending short-term check out metadata to the first client to begin an editing session. The method also includes writing the transition ID to a transition table stored in a cache, wherein the presence of another transition ID in the cache indicates that a document has switched from a single-client mode to a multi-client mode. An example system includes a processing unit operative to receive a document, the document including short-term check out metadata indicating an editing session has begun, ping a cache to determine if another transition ID is stored in the cache, and send a transition ID to a transition table stored in a cache to switch from a single-client mode to a multi-client mode.
    Type: Application
    Filed: June 13, 2012
    Publication date: October 4, 2012
    Applicant: Microsoft Corporation
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Patent number: 8176005
    Abstract: Example systems and methods are directed at maintaining and retrieving presence metadata. One example method includes receiving a request from a first client to edit a document file, and sending short-term check out metadata to the first client to begin an editing session. The method also includes writing the transition ID to a transition table stored in a cache, wherein the presence of another transition ID in the cache indicates that a document has switched from a single-client mode to a multi-client mode. An example system includes a processing unit operative to receive a document, the document including short-term check out metadata indicating an editing session has begun, ping a cache to determine if another transition ID is stored in the cache, and send a transition ID to a transition table stored in a cache to switch from a single-client mode to a multi-client mode.
    Type: Grant
    Filed: May 8, 2008
    Date of Patent: May 8, 2012
    Assignee: Microsoft Corporation
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Publication number: 20100241760
    Abstract: A server computer includes a performance monitor module and a throttling logic module. The performance monitor module includes performance monitors that monitor system parameters of the server computer. The throttling logic module determines whether a system parameter monitored by a performance monitor exceeds a predetermined threshold. When a system parameter exceeds a predetermined threshold, the throttling logic module sets a throttling flag. The throttling logic module activates throttling at the server computer when at least one throttling flag is set for each of a predetermined number of time snapshots. The activation of throttling limits the processing of request messages received by the server computer.
    Type: Application
    Filed: March 18, 2009
    Publication date: September 23, 2010
    Applicant: Microsoft Corporation
    Inventors: Jian Zhang, Lida Li, Christopher` Anthony Clark, JR., Ivonne Dnisse Galvan Coiffier, Rahul Sakdeo, Don Adam Hedgpeth, Seth A. Sanusi
  • Publication number: 20090282462
    Abstract: Examples are related to systems and methods for controlling access to document files on a document server. One example system includes document files stored on a document server, at least one of the document files referencing a file lock, and a document access processing module. The example document access processing module includes a file sharing processing module that determines a coauthoring status of a software application of a client computer requesting access to the document file, and a file lock processing module that stores one or more file locks and that controls the setting and resetting of file locks. The example document access processing module uses the coauthoring status of the software application and the file lock status of a document file to determine whether a software application is permitted to have write access to the document file.
    Type: Application
    Filed: May 8, 2008
    Publication date: November 12, 2009
    Applicant: MICROSOFT CORPORATION
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Publication number: 20090282041
    Abstract: Example systems and methods are directed at maintaining and retrieving presence metadata. One example method includes receiving a request from a first client to edit a document file, and sending short-term check out metadata to the first client to begin an editing session. The method also includes writing the transition ID to a transition table stored in a cache, wherein the presence of another transition ID in the cache indicates that a document has switched from a single-client mode to a multi-client mode. An example system includes a processing unit operative to receive a document, the document including short-term check out metadata indicating an editing session has begun, ping a cache to determine if another transition ID is stored in the cache, and send a transition ID to a transition table stored in a cache to switch from a single-client mode to a multi-client mode.
    Type: Application
    Filed: May 8, 2008
    Publication date: November 12, 2009
    Applicant: MICROSOFT CORPORATION
    Inventors: Simon Skaria, Naresh Kannan, Simon Peter Clarke, Miko Arnab Sakhya Singha Bose, Christopher J. Antos, Mark Rolland Knight, Andrew G. Carlson, Don Adam Hedgpeth, Mitesh Pankaj Patel, Andrew Sean Watson, Jonathan B. Bailor, Elena Petrova
  • Publication number: 20090089871
    Abstract: The invention provides, in one aspect, a digital data processing device includes a firewall device and a computer, both housed within the same enclosure and sharing a common path to the Internet (or other external network), yet, not sharing the same substantive processing logic. Thus, by way of example, the firewall device does not the computer's central processing unit (CPU) to execute firewall logic. The digital data processing device can be arranged to limit connectivity and/or functionality of the computer and/or firewall device, e.g., absent authentication. Thus, for example, the computer and firewall can be coupled to the common path—e.g., a modem, network interface card or other communications port supporting access via wired (e.g., wired ethernet and coaxial), wireless (e.g., satellite, telephony, 802.11x), and/or optical (e.g., fiber) means—such that that access by the computer to the Internet (or other external network) is mediated by the firewall device.
    Type: Application
    Filed: July 5, 2006
    Publication date: April 2, 2009
    Applicant: NETWORK ENGINES, INC.
    Inventors: Kevin J. Murphy, JR., John Amaral, Don Adams
  • Publication number: 20070093963
    Abstract: A collision damage prevention system is disclosed which may be installed on many standard powered mobility vehicles for handicapped persons. The system includes an array of one or more sensors placed around the periphery of the powered mobility vehicle, a switch for each sensor, and a central control module which receives input from the switches, turns the vehicle off and/or applies braking power to prevent damage from a collision. The system then prompts the operator to acknowledge the collision and guides the operator into the appropriate direction to move the vehicle's controls in order to move away from the object collided with.
    Type: Application
    Filed: December 12, 2006
    Publication date: April 26, 2007
    Inventor: Don Adams
  • Patent number: 6017106
    Abstract: An easily and conveniently attachable/detachable carrying handle and insert is disclosed which may be used with a portable computer. The insert has a retention member and is engageable by a latch mechanism of the computer housing and may be attached to the computer housing or substituted for a removeable device bay unit.
    Type: Grant
    Filed: February 2, 1999
    Date of Patent: January 25, 2000
    Assignee: Gateway 2000, Inc
    Inventors: Don Adams, Eric S. Turner